Struttura TBADDBITMAP (commctrl.h)
Aggiunge una bitmap contenente immagini pulsante a una barra degli strumenti.
Sintassi
typedef struct tagTBADDBITMAP {
HINSTANCE hInst;
UINT_PTR nID;
} TBADDBITMAP, *LPTBADDBITMAP;
Members
hInst
Tipo: HINSTANCE
Gestire l'istanza del modulo con il file eseguibile che contiene una risorsa bitmap. Per usare handle bitmap anziché ID risorsa, impostare questo membro su NULL.
È possibile aggiungere le bitmap del pulsante definite dal sistema all'elenco specificando HINST_COMMCTRL come membro hInst e uno dei valori seguenti come membro nID .
nID
Tipo: UINT_PTR
Se hInst è NULL, impostare questo membro sull'handle bitmap della bitmap con le immagini del pulsante. In caso contrario, impostarlo sull'identificatore di risorsa della bitmap con le immagini del pulsante.
Commenti
Se nID contiene un handle bitmap anziché un ID risorsa, non eliminare la bitmap finché non è stata sostituita con TB_REPLACEBITMAP. In caso contrario, la barra degli strumenti viene eliminata.
I valori definiti possono essere usati come indici per le bitmap standard. Per altre informazioni, vedere Valori di indice dell'indice dell'immagine del pulsante standard della barra degli strumenti.
La struttura TBADDBITMAP viene usata con il messaggio di TB_ADDBITMAP .
Requisiti
Requisito | Valore |
---|---|
Client minimo supportato | Windows Vista [solo app desktop] |
Server minimo supportato | Windows Server 2003 [solo app desktop] |
Intestazione | commctrl.h |